What is the Solana Blockchain?
Solana is a high-performance, decentralized blockchain platform designed to facilitate fast and secure transactions. Launched in March 2020, the Solana blockchain is praised for its innovative architecture that combines various advanced technologies to achieve remarkable throughput and efficiency. The platform supports smart contracts and decentralized applications (dApps), positioning itself as a robust competitor against other blockchains like Ethereum.
The Core Features of Solana
High Throughput: Solana is capable of processing over 65,000 transactions per second (TPS) without compromising security or decentralization. This is possible due to its unique proof-of-history (PoH) consensus algorithm.
Low Transaction Costs: With transaction fees averaging around $0.00025, Solana offers an economical solution for users and developers looking to leverage blockchain technology without incurring exorbitant costs.
Scalability: As the user base and transaction volume increase, Solana can seamlessly scale without a detrimental impact on performance—thanks to its innovative architecture.
Developer-Friendly: Solana supports multiple programming languages, including Rust and C, making it accessible to a broad range of developers. The platform's documentation and community support are also top-notch, fostering innovation.
How Does Solana Work?
At its core, Solana operates on a unique consensus mechanism called Proof of History (PoH). This mechanism timestamps transactions, creating a historical record that aids in the validation and ordering of transactions on the blockchain. Let’s delve deeper into how Solana’s PoH offers remarkable efficiency.
The Proof of History Mechanism
Proof of History (PoH) serves as the backbone of Solana’s transaction processing. Here’s a simplified breakdown of how it operates:
Generating Timestamps: PoH generates a unique cryptographic proof for every transaction, allowing for precise timestamps.
Transaction Ordering: By validating and ordering transactions ahead of time, Solana can process them without waiting for other validators' input.
Streamlined Validation: Validators can quickly verify the validity of transactions based on the predetermined order, significantly reducing confirmation times.
This method of ordering and validating transactions provides Solana with its remarkable scalability and speed. By enabling each transaction to be processed independently, much like a highly efficient assembly line, Solana ensures that users experience minimal delays and interruptions.
The Ecosystem of Solana
Solana has nurtured a vibrant ecosystem that hosts various applications ranging from decentralized finance (DeFi) to non-fungible tokens (NFTs). Here's a closer look at some of the key sectors thriving on the Solana blockchain:
Decentralized Finance (DeFi)
DeFi, or decentralized finance, is reshaping the financial landscape by offering traditional financial services through decentralized platforms. Solana has become a hotspot for DeFi projects due to its speed and low transaction fees. Some popular DeFi protocols on Solana include:
Raydium: An automated market maker (AMM) that provides liquidity for trading pairs.
Serum: A decentralized exchange (DEX) that facilitates fast transactions and cross-chain trading.
Marinade Finance: A staking protocol that simplifies the process of staking SOL (Solana’s native currency).
Non-Fungible Tokens (NFTs)
The NFT space has exploded in recent years, and Solana is not immune to this trend. The platform's low fees and high speeds make it an attractive option for creators and collectors alike. Notable NFT platforms on Solana include:
Metaplex: A framework for creating and launching NFT storefronts on the Solana blockchain.
SolanArt: A marketplace for trading Solana-based NFTs, making it easy for users to buy and sell digital collectibles.
Gaming and Other Applications
Blockchain gaming is gaining momentum, and Solana is leading the charge with several innovative projects that leverage its technology. Games such asStar AtlasandAuroryare utilizing the speed and cost-effectiveness of Solana to enhance user experience and engagement.
Additionally, other applications ranging from supply chain tracking to decentralized identity verification are being developed on the Solana infrastructure, showcasing its versatility.

The Challenges Facing Solana
While Solana boasts many benefits, it’s essential to acknowledge the challenges it faces. These challenges can impact its growth trajectory and user adoption:
Centralization Concerns: Critics argue that Solana's architecture may promote centralization, putting control in the hands of a few validators.
Network Outages: There have been instances of network outages due to traffic spikes, raising concerns about reliability during high-demand periods.
Competition: With numerous other blockchain platforms competing for market share, Solana needs to distinguish itself continuously and respond to the evolving landscape.
